Things to do in Tucson?
Tucson, Arizona is an exciting and vibrant city with an array of attractions. Explore the Mission San Xavier del Bac or take a trip to nearby Sabino Canyon for some outdoor recreation. Spend the day touring the Arizona-Sonora Desert Museum or visit downtown Tucscon for some great shopping and dining. Those looking for a more adventurous experience can visit Saguaro National Park or try their hand at rock climbing in Tucson Mountain Park. From its unique desert beauty to its interesting culture, Tucson is sure to provide an unforgettable experience!

Things to do in Saline?
Living in Saline, MI is a wonderful experience. The city is located in Washtenaw County and has a population of approximately 8,200 people. The community is welcoming and friendly and there are plenty of opportunities to get involved with local activities. Saline is known for its excellent schools, parks, and trails as well as an active arts community with numerous galleries, theatre companies, and music venues. People enjoy the unique blend of small town hospitality and modern amenities that makes living in Saline so enjoyable. Shopping, dining, and entertainment are all easily accessible from this vibrant city center. With beautiful neighborhoods, open spaces, parks, trails, lakes and more Saline offers something for everyone!
